In "Two Kinds," what does the mother hope for her daughter? A. a meeting with Ed Sullivan B. a way to happiness C. a good career
tester [92]

Answer:

D. A special talent.

Explanation:

Amy Tan's "Two Kinds" revolves around the story of Jing-mei and her mother who has high expectations from her daughter. The story delves into the theme of discovering one's identity, while also trying to remain rooted in one's roots.

Jing-mei and her family have immigrated to America from China and thus, the identity crisis. While she is busy trying to find her place in the adopted society, her mother also has her own expectations of what her daughter must become. <u>She wants her daughter to learn a special talent so that she can become a child prodigy like those rare and lucky people.</u>

Reread lines 40-54 of "The Wanderer." To whom or what does the phrase alone
Vsevolod [243]

The phrase applies to an exiled man.

We can reach this conclusion because:

  • "The Wanderer" is an Anglo-Saxon poem that portrays the disadvantages of being an exiled person.
  • The poem presents a man who has been removed from his people and now walks without any company.
  • The poem shows how difficult this life of solitude is, because, besides the lack of company, man lives without love and no one to count on.
  • However, this man has great faith and believed that all the suffering he is experiencing will pass one day.

By this, when the speaker says "alone and unloved," he is referring to the way the exiled man lives.
